Radical Jaguar Rebrand: A Controversial Makeover
Introduction (Attention):
Jaguar's new brand identity, revealed today, marks a radical departure from its established image. This isn't simply a logo tweak; it's a complete overhaul aiming to project a more modern, sustainable, and technologically advanced brand. The question is: will this bold strategy pay off, or has Jaguar alienated its core fanbase?
Key Aspects (Interest):
The rebrand centers on several key elements: a significantly simplified logo, a renewed focus on electric vehicles, and a revamped marketing strategy emphasizing sustainability and a younger target demographic. The new logo ditches the leaping jaguar for a sleek, minimalist design.
In-Depth Analysis (Desire):
The minimalist logo, while undeniably modern, has been met with harsh criticism. Many longtime Jaguar enthusiasts feel it lacks the heritage and iconic feel of the previous logo, viewing it as a betrayal of the brand's legacy. The shift towards electric vehicles, although necessary for future viability in the automotive industry, has also fueled concerns among some consumers who associate Jaguar with powerful, gas-guzzling engines. The marketing strategy, while aiming for a broader appeal, risks alienating the existing, more traditional customer base. We are seeing a similar pattern to other established brands that have undergone radical rebrands – a risk-reward scenario.
The New Logo: A Symbol of Change or Erasure?
Introduction (Attention):
The new Jaguar logo is the most immediately visible element of the rebrand, and it's also the source of the most controversy. Its stark simplicity stands in sharp contrast to the more complex and detailed previous logo.
Facets (Interest):
The new logo's minimalist design is meant to symbolize a modern, clean aesthetic. However, critics point to the loss of the leaping jaguar, a powerful and recognizable symbol deeply ingrained in the brand's identity. The simplification might appeal to a younger generation, but it could also be perceived as a lack of respect for the brand's rich history. The risk here lies in alienating a loyal customer base. Its potential is limited unless supported by a broader marketing campaign that justifies its new appeal.
Summary (Desire):
The new logo's reception underlines the delicate balance between modernization and heritage preservation in brand rebranding. The success of this design element hinges on whether Jaguar can effectively communicate its new vision without completely abandoning its past.
